Monday, August 25, 2014 - Very pretty nose: fresh, focused note of lychee, peach, lemon, white flowers. Body is medium-full, mouthfeel rounded, with a creamy texture and soft acids. A hint of sweetness left over, or maybe that’s from the alcohol. Overall, definitely a high quality wine, though perhaps not exactly to my style because I prefer more crisp whites (light body, high acid). It is high in alcohol (14.5%), but the alcohol does not come through in the aroma, only in the body and finish of the wine.

Friulano is a white grape pretty much only grown in Friuli and surrounding areas. It is related to Sauvignon Blanc, with which it shares certain characteristics, like higher acidity and that strange cat-pee quality, though to a lesser degree.
